Block #68986

Block Hash
fdd2757d31c5405b5a3b50dde7a8e7618a8434ac064fe6c43d2762011cb77011
Previous Block
Merkle Root
5ce571c5...73a68c7b
Timestamp
(13 days ago)
Difficulty
0.00908588
Size
312 bytes
Nonce
453771264

Transactions 1

Transaction ID Size
5ce571c5...73a68c7b 231 bytes